Seller's Description

• Streaming Preamplifier Overview – The Naim NAC-N272 Streaming Preamplifier combines high-grade analogue preamplification with integrated network streaming, offering exceptional timing accuracy and clarity in a streamlined, high-performance control centre for modern audio systems.

• Digital Architecture & DAC Performance – Using advanced DSP processing, precision clocking and a high-quality DAC section, the Naim NAC-N272 Streaming Preamplifier delivers detailed resolution, smooth tonal balance and stable digital playback across a wide range of formats.

• Streaming Features & Connectivity – Equipped with UPnP streaming, Spotify Connect, Bluetooth aptX, multiple digital inputs and analogue outputs, the Naim NAC-N272 Streaming Preamplifier integrates flexibly into hybrid systems requiring both streaming and preamp functionality.

• Power Supply Compatibility & Sonic Benefits – Designed to pair with Naim upgrade supplies such as the XPS or 555PS, the Naim NAC-N272 Streaming Preamplifier improves transient behaviour, noise performance and overall musical engagement when externally powered.

• Product Dimensions – Measures 432 mm (W) × 87 mm (H) × 314 mm (D), featuring Naim’s rigid, low-resonance casework engineered to enhance mechanical stability and reduce vibrational interference.

• Product Weight – Weighs approximately 10 kg, with a robust internal layout and linear power design that contribute to improved grounding, cleaner dynamics and greater system transparency.

About Naim Audio

Naim Audio, a cornerstone of British hi-fi excellence, traces its origins to 1973 when Julian Vereker, a self-taught engineer, racing driver, and music enthusiast, formally incorporated the company in Salisbury, Wiltshire. Vereker's journey began earlier, in 1969, experimenting with tape recording and sound-to-light boxes before designing his first power amplifier in 1971. Amid the British hi-fi industry's recession, he secured a pivotal contract with Capital Radio, blending entrepreneurial grit with a passion for authentic sound reproduction that challenged conventional wisdom.

The brand specializes in premium integrated amplifiers, power amplifiers, preamplifiers, digital streamers, DACs, and compact music systems, often featuring built-in amplification for streamlined setups. While not delving into speakers—beyond a historical foray—or headphones and turntables, Naim emphasizes modular, upgradable components that prioritize pace, rhythm, and timing (PRaT), a signature sonic philosophy rooted in the "source first" approach alongside contemporaries like Linn.

Naim holds a commanding position in the high-end market, revered by discerning audiophiles for its handmade, innovative systems that deliver emotional musical engagement over mere specifications. Now part of VerVent Audio Group following a 2011 merger with Focal, it exports to over 45 countries, sustaining a cult following for resilient, influential designs that transcend economic cycles.
